I'd recommend following Lbabinz on Discord, not Twitter. You can then get notifications directly from the bots he uses to scour stock drops, instead of waiting for him to tweet about it. Even a few minutes can make all the difference between snagging something or missing out. Plus that way you can tailor notifications to only the items you're looking for, instead of having Twitter go off for every gaming related post he makes (which is a lot)

If you're going to participate in The Trial in FH5 then:
a) Get a proper tune so you're competitive. /r/forza has tuners who kindly share amazing tunes.
b) Don't ram your teammates. Making someone miss a checkpoint will guarantee a loss. Honk if you need to pass a slower car.
c) If you're at the back of the back just admit defeat and quit the race. You're doing more harm than good getting zero points and giving the other team 100 each.
d) Learn how to drive. Barrelling into the corners is not going to win you races. Learn brake and throttle control and take off the other nanny systems that only hold you back. This isn't a huge deal like the previous tips. Not everyone can dedicate the time to get good. I'll take a rookie with a proper tune over a veteran who rams.
